Appendix A: OPW Smart Sensors
Interstitial Level Sensor Float Switch
OPW P/N: 30-0231-S
Interstitial Level Sensors are used primarily in the interstitial area of a
steel double-walled tank. The sensor contains a float switch that
activates in the presence of a liquid. The sensor is constructed from
chemical-resistant non-metallic material. It can also be used in
sumps, dispenser pans and other locations where the presence of a
liquid could indicate that a leak has occurred. In the event of a break
in the cable, the system will activate the alarm.
This technology allows the Integra and I.S. barrier to automatically
detect sensor connection, sensor type and sensor status, will
minimize user entry error and identify hardware issues with minimal
troubleshooting.
Interstitial Level Sensor Float Switch Specifications
Primary Use(s):
Interstitial Area
Alternate Use(s):
Sumps and Dispenser Pans
Detects:
Liquid
Operating Temperature:
-40°F to 168°F (-40°C to +70°C)
Dimensions:
Length: 3.9” (9.9 cm); Diameter: 1.3”
(3.3 cm)
Cable Requirements:
Belden #88760 or Alpha #55371
Maximum Wiring Length*:
1,000’ (305 m) field wiring
Multi-Drop Restriction:
16 per I.S. barrier channel (64 per
barrier)
Connections:
Red = Power, Black = Signal, Shield =
Ground
*NOTE: Maximum Wiring Length is the maximum length of cable to
be used to connect all sensors on an individual channel. This length
includes run of cable from I.S. Barrier to each sensor board in the
string.
